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
140675901 0109619585 80577149
47063 351993 499701774
47063 351993 499701774
2901976520 15970 26171709 014095649
All about undefined
Interested in learning more?
47063 351993 499701774
2901976520 15970 26171709 014095649
See more
72442479150 534 007252
67275 415434312 85984301
See more
3727 891 7299
15048 928 43739
See more